File No. 857.857/119

The Consul at Cardiff ( Lathrop) to the Secretary of State

[Telegram]

Frederick Kragel, American fireman, Norwegian unarmed steamer Sandvik, Goole, England, to Göteborg, cargo iron and iron ore, reports vessel sunk by submarine believed German, about noon, 27th, [Page 204] 5 miles off Aberdeen. Warned, sank in 15 minutes after crew left. Weather clear, cold. Sea rough. Wind high. No vessel in sight. No passengers. Crew rescued after two hours by British mine sweeper and landed Aberdeen. No casualties.

Lathrop
